package com.amazonaws.services.iot.model;

import java.io.Serializable;
import javax.annotation.Generated;

import com.amazonaws.AmazonWebServiceRequest;

@Generated("com.amazonaws:aws-java-sdk-code-generator")
public class DeleteJobExecutionRequest extends com.amazonaws.AmazonWebServiceRequest implements Serializable, Cloneable {

    /**
     * 

* The ID of the job whose execution on a particular device will be deleted. *

*/ private String jobId; /** *

* The name of the thing whose job execution will be deleted. *

*/ private String thingName; /** *

* The ID of the job execution to be deleted. The executionNumber refers to the execution of a * particular job on a particular device. *

*

* Note that once a job execution is deleted, the executionNumber may be reused by IoT, so be sure you * get and use the correct value here. *

*/ private Long executionNumber; /** *

* (Optional) When true, you can delete a job execution which is "IN_PROGRESS". Otherwise, you can only delete a job * execution which is in a terminal state ("SUCCEEDED", "FAILED", "REJECTED", "REMOVED" or "CANCELED") or an * exception will occur. The default is false. *

* *

* Deleting a job execution which is "IN_PROGRESS", will cause the device to be unable to access job information or * update the job execution status. Use caution and ensure that the device is able to recover to a valid state. *

*
*/ private Boolean force; /** *
